I stole wi-fi service today

August 11, 2007

Okay officially I don’t think this is criminal.  Because Panera Bread makes their wi-fi publicly available.  But today I surfed on Panera’s wi-fi from the McDonald’s across the street.  So in a way I did steal the service since I wasn’t buying anything from Panera.

See last week I was at Panera and noticed that I was able to see the Wayport access point located at the McDonald’s across the street.  So it was natural to wonder if the opposite were true, if I could see Panera’s access point while at the McDonald’s.  Today I tested the theory and it does indeed work.

There’s just times when I’m not really in the mood for Panera food.  I’m not a coffee drinker so the only things I really pick up an Panera are the baked goods and the occasional soup & salad combo.  Other times I still want to get out of the house and surf the Internet but do so while munching on french fries or a cheeseburger. 

Now it turns out I can.  At least on this one corner where Mickey-D’s and Panera are diagonally opposite from each other.
